Technion researchers have created a micro robot that can crawl through the human body.

Moving reality a step closer to "Fantastic Voyage," researchers at the Technion-Israel Institute of Technology have developed a micro robot that can crawl through the human body.

The robot is propelled by micro legs, a mechanism especially adapted to the movements of a tiny body through water. It is only a millimeter in diameter and 14 millimeters long, fitting on the tip of a finger, so it can get into the body’s smallest areas. It is powered by either actuation through magnetic force located outside the body, or through an on-board actuation system. Made of silicone and metal, it can be made completely biocompatible, so it could remain in the body much as a stent placed in arteries does.

“In the future, we hope the robot will be able to travel through a blood vessel, the digestive tract or the lungs, delivering targeted medicines to specific locations, clearing blockages, performing biopsies, or placed inside a shunt to drain body fluids from clogged areas,” Shoham explains.

The development has been presented at scientific conferences where it has aroused great interest. Professor Menashe Zaaroor and research engineer Oded Salomon also participated in the research.
